Flashing repair services involve fixing or replacing the flashing components around a property’s roof, chimneys, vents, and skylights. Flashing is a crucial element that directs water away from vulnerable areas, preventing leaks and water intrusion. Over time, flashing can become damaged, corroded, or displaced due to weather exposure, leading to potential water entry. Professional contractors can assess the condition of existing flashing, identify areas of concern, and perform repairs or replacements to ensure the structure remains watertight. Proper flashing maintenance is essential for protecting a property’s interior from water damage and avoiding costly repairs down the line.

Many common problems can be addressed through flashing repair services. These include leaks around chimneys, vents, or roof penetrations, where old or damaged flashing no longer provides an effective seal. Cracks, rust, or missing sections of flashing can allow water to seep into the roof or walls, causing issues like mold, rot, or structural damage. Additionally, flashing that has shifted or become loose due to high winds or settling can create gaps that let moisture in. Service providers can restore the integrity of flashing systems, helping to prevent further damage and extend the lifespan of roofing components.

When signs of water stains, mold growth, or musty odors appear on interior walls or ceilings, flashing problems might be the cause. Visible damage like rust, cracks, or displaced flashing around roof openings also indicate that repairs are needed. Homeowners who notice recurring leaks after storms or see water pooling on their roof surface should consider professional flashing inspection and repair. What causes flashing to need repair? Flashing can be damaged by severe weather, corrosion, or age, leading to leaks or water intrusion that require professional repair.

How do professionals repair or replace damaged flashing? Service providers assess the extent of damage, remove old or broken flashing, and install new, properly sealed flashing to prevent leaks.

Can damaged flashing lead to other roof issues? Yes, compromised flashing can cause water leaks, wood rot, and mold growth if not repaired promptly by experienced contractors.

What types of flashing services are available in Painesville, OH? Local contractors offer repair, replacement, and installation of various flashing types, including step flashing, continuous flashing, and pipe flashing.

How can I tell if my flashing needs repair? Signs include water stains on ceilings or walls, visible rust or corrosion, and cracked or missing flashing around roof features.
